Airlie Beach sits at the edge of the Coral Sea in Queensland's Whitsunday region, a small town that punches well above its weight as a gateway to one of the most celebrated stretches of coastline on earth. The Great Barrier Reef lies to the north-east, and the 74 islands of the Whitsunday archipelago fan out just offshore, making this compact strip of foreshore and marina one of the most strategically placed towns in the whole of Australia. The population is modest, the main street is short, and yet the volume of natural spectacle on offer from this single point of departure is genuinely difficult to overstate.

The town itself occupies a narrow coastal shelf between forested hills and the Coral Sea, and its geography shapes everything about how visitors move through it. Most activity concentrates around the Airlie Beach foreshore and the adjacent Abell Point Marina, where charter vessels, sailing boats, and expedition craft depart daily for the islands. The lagoon at the foreshore, a large saltwater swimming enclosure, gives swimmers a safe alternative to the open water during stinger season, which runs through the warmer months from around November to May. Outside that window, the climate remains warm and the pace of the town shifts slightly, drawing a different kind of traveller who prefers quieter anchorages and less crowded decks.
